4.5 The urban forward collision warning system (uFCWS)
When the vehicle drives at 30 km/h or lower, the uFCWS will detect forward collision danger via the real-
time video image and warn the driver.
Preliminary low speed forward collision warning:
Displayed when a preliminary low speed collision
hazard is detected.
Secondary low speed forward collision warning:
Displayed when the distance to the vehicle ahead
decreases after a preliminary low speed collision
warning.

For your safety, the low-speed forward collision
warning will be displayed on the LCD even when
the LCD is turned off.
To deactivate the uFCWS or change the warning sensitivity, tap the Home menu ( ) button on the Live
view screen
>
Settings
>
Road Safety Settings, and then tap the button next to Low Speed FCWS under
ADAS Features to switch the sensitivity option (Low/Mid/High) to set the detection sensitivity, or OFF to
deactivate the feature.
